Does Kentucky use NGSS?

Yes, Kentucky is one of 24 states to fully adopt the Next Generation Science Standards (NGSS) as of 2017. The Kentucky Board of Education deliberated over the standards in 2016 before voting to fully adopt them in November of that year.

The NGSS are a set of learning expectations in science for grades K-12 that were developed in collaboration between states and curriculum experts. The standards emphasize the development of critical thinking and scientific investigation skills, rather than simply memorizing facts.

The standards also integrate the three dimensions of science — science and engineering practices, disciplinary core ideas, and crosscutting concepts — to build a more complete understanding of the subject.

The implementation of the NGSS in Kentucky is designed to create a more rigorous and hands-on approach to science education.

What is the difference between CCSS and NGSS?

The Common Core State Standards (CCSS) and the Next Generation Science Standards (NGSS) are two sets of educational standards that shape what students learn in K–12 classrooms. Although they both aim to help students meet the same rigorous educational requirements, they differ in three main ways.

Firstly, there is a difference in what is covered by each set of standards. The CCSS focus on math and language arts, while the NGSS focuses on science and engineering. Secondly, CCSS and NGSS are framed differently.

CCSS is content-based, focusing on what students must achieve in each subject. In contrast, the NGSS is more of a process-based standard, encouraging students to engage with the material through experiment, inquiry and problem solving.

Lastly, the development process for CCSS and NGSS varies. The CCSS were compiled by a consortium of state governments, while NGSS was developed by 26 states and numerous national organizations.

Ultimately, regardless of the differences between CCSS and NGSS, both sets of standards share the same goal: to ensure a high level of education for all students.

Is NGSS mandated by the federal government?

No, NGSS (or the Next Generation Science Standards) are not mandated by the federal government. NGSS are a set of voluntary, K-12 science education standards developed as part of a state-led effort coordinated by the National Academies of Sciences, Engineering, and Medicine.

The standards were created by states, and are being voluntarily adopted by a growing number of states across the country. While the federal government does not mandate the states to adopt or use the standards, funding is sometimes provided to states that choose to implement the standards.

The federal government does support efforts to improve science education, including programs designed to increase student engagement and achievement, specific science education programs, and teacher professional development opportunities.

How many NGSS standards are there?

The Next Generation Science Standards (NGSS) developed by the National Research Council represent an important shift in the way science is taught in the United States. The standards are designed to provide an overarching framework and foundation for all K–12 schools to use as they develop their science curriculum.

Within the NGSS are, in total, roughly 92 performance expectations across the four grade bands of K–2, 3–5, 6–8 and 9–12. These performance expectations, when combined with core disciplinary ideas, science and engineering practices and crosscutting concepts, form the complete NGSS framework.

Why are people against CCSS?

The Common Core State Standards (CCSS) have been highly contested since their implementation in 2010, with many people arguing that they do not facilitate the best quality of education and can lead to increased standardization.

Opponents of the CCSS note that it encourages a “one-size-fits-all” approach to education and that it limits the creativity of teachers and students. Some argue that the standards are too difficult and may discourage students who are not performing as well academically as other students.

Additionally, opponents argue that the standards impose a certain set of values on students and communities that may not align with their ideology or beliefs.

Another large concern with the CCSS is the use of the high-stakes standardized tests, which are used to determine how well the students and schools are doing in regards to the standards. Opponents argue that this method of evaluation does not provide an accurate reflection of a student’s intelligence or understanding and can lead to an overreliance on test scores to determine educational outcomes.

In addition to these issues, opponents have argued that the CCSS has promoted a corporate reform agenda, where profit is placed before students’ best interests. They note that the CCSS has been heavily influenced by corporations and private organizations, leaving many concerned about the influence that these outside entities may have on education.

Additionally, they are concerned that the CCSS do not prioritize the teaching of minority cultures, nor do they prioritize the teaching of more traditionally ‘non-academic’ courses such as visual arts, music, and physical education.

Overall, while the CCSS may provide a structured, consistent approach to education, opponents argue that it leaves less room for teacher creativity and student engagement and can lead to increased standardization and a corporate-driven agenda.

For these reasons, people are often against the CCSS.

What is meant by CCSS?

CCSS stands for Common Core State Standards. These are academic standards developed by the National Governors Association Center for Best Practices and the Council of Chief State School Officers. They outline the academic expectations for students in language arts, mathematics, and literacy in history and social studies, science, and technical subjects.

The goal of the CCSS is to create a set of clear, consistent expectations that all students should reach, regardless of where they live in the United States. These standards aim to provide a common understanding of what students should know and be able to do in each grade.

The CCSS are built on American standards but are internationally benchmarked to prepare students for the global economy. Additionally, the CCSS teach students how to analyze and think critically about problems and prepare them for college and career readiness.

What are the Kentucky Academic Standards Kas and what is their purpose?

The Kentucky Academic Standards (KAS) are a set of academic standards developed by the Kentucky Board of Education to provide a consistent and rigorous program of instruction for public schools in the state.

The standards describe the academic knowledge and skills that students should master to become college and career ready and successful citizens. They are arranged into four main content areas: English Language Arts, Mathematics, Science, and Social Studies.

The purpose of the KAS is to provide an outline of the knowledge and skills students should master at each grade level. The standards are designed to ensure students have a comprehensive education and develop knowledge and skills needed to prepare them for successful post-secondary experiences.

The standards are also designed to provide educators with a guide for what content should be taught and how it should be taught. By setting and measuring academic standards, the Kentucky Board of Education helps ensure that all students in the state receive a quality education.

What are the two versions of Common Core State Standards?

The Common Core State Standards (CCSS) are educational standards developed in the United States to help ensure that all students receive the same education regardless of geography, income level, or other factors.

The CCSS have been adopted in most states and are used to determine what topics should be taught in schools and how they should be assessed.

The two versions of the Common Core State Standards are the English Language Arts & Literacy (ELA/Literacy) standards and the Mathematics standards. The ELA/Literacy standards focus on developing students’ reading, writing, speaking, listening, and language skills.

The Mathematics standards cover topics such as arithmetic, algebra, geometry, data analysis, and probability.

The ELA/Literacy and Mathematics standards are designed to prepare students for college and the workplace by focusing on critical thinking, problem solving, and research skills. Both sets of standards are organized around the same overarching principles and goals, such as enabling students to use evidence to support their arguments and convey their understanding of a concept.
